March 31 - April 2, 2025, in Las Vegas, Nevada. Use code MSCUST for a $150 discount! Early bird discount ends December 31.
Register NowBe one of the first to start using Fabric Databases. View on-demand sessions with database experts and the Microsoft product team to learn just how easy it is to get started. Watch now
Hello
I have a csv with lots of data.
Is it possible to design a power bi so that at every year a new page and within a visual is created?
Another way would be to insert there a template and with every new year a new page with the layout of the template is created.
Once published could that be also done automatically in Power BI Service.
Regards
Heinrich
Hello, amitchandak,thanks for your concern about this issue.
Your answer is excellent!
And I would like to share some additional solutions below.
Hi,@Heinrich.I am glad to help you.
According to your description, you want to implement power bi to automatically create new report pages based on year turnover and apply filters.
Here are some of my suggestions for your needs.
I didn't find the easiest way how Power BI can automatically create new report pages, but I think your second idea is doable: by creating a template
You can create a template page in Power BI that contains all the required visuals and layouts. Manually copy that page each year and update the data filters. This is the easiest and most straightforward method, but it requires manual work.
Regarding automated operations, Power Automate as well as the Power BI REST API can help you with a range of operations in power bi, but I doubt they can be detailed enough to create report pages. Because the design of the report often requires complex logical judgment and involves the degree of aesthetics, whether it is easy for the audience to read and other issues, these needs are currently more difficult to achieve through the code.
But they can help you automate a series of other operations related to reporting , such as
1. Get all your Power BI Service workspace, data sets, data flow, reports and dashboards and other information
2. Adding or deleting data by rows to a specified table in a specified Power BI dataset, or even creating a new dataset.
3. Modify the settings of any workspace, dataset, data flow, report and dashboard in your Power BI Service.
4. Perform one or more tasks within Power BI Service, such as refreshing datasets and so on.
You can try to use them to perform some operations on dataset management to make your report management more convenient.
I hope my suggestions give you good ideas, if you have any more questions, please clarify in a follow-up reply.
Best Regards,
Carson Jian,
If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.
Hello @v-jtian-msft
Thank you very much for your detailed answer.
I will do as suggested.
Regards
JFM_12
Hello @amitchandak
Thank you very much.
It could be a nice feature especially when the data is so big that you need to refine the filters
Regards
Heinrich
@Heinrich , I doubt that. Sempy is an powerful library, but I doubt that can add a page
March 31 - April 2, 2025, in Las Vegas, Nevada. Use code MSCUST for a $150 discount!
Arun Ulag shares exciting details about the Microsoft Fabric Conference 2025, which will be held in Las Vegas, NV.
User | Count |
---|---|
114 | |
76 | |
57 | |
52 | |
44 |
User | Count |
---|---|
164 | |
116 | |
63 | |
57 | |
50 |